ADC Therapeutics reported a Q1 2026 EPS of -$0.13, exceeding the consensus estimate of -$0.2193 by a 40.72% surprise. However, the company reported no revenue for the quarter, with no comparable estimate available. The stock declined by $0.29 following the announcement, reflecting ongoing investor concerns about the lack of top-line growth.

The narrower-than-expected loss was driven primarily by disciplined expense management, as ADC Therapeutics continued to control operating costs while advancing its pipeline. With no product-related revenue reported in Q1 2026, the company remains in a pre-commercial or early-revenue stage, relying on its existing cash reserves to fund research and development. Key business drivers during the quarter likely included progress on clinical trials for its CD19‑targeted antibody-drug conjugate, Zynlonta, and other pipeline candidates. However, specific operational highlights such as enrollment updates or new data readouts were not detailed in the earnings release. The lack of revenue underscores the challenges faced by the biotech firm as it works to transition from a development‑stage to a commercial‑stage company. Margins remain negative, and cash burn continues to be a critical area for investor focus. The company may have also recorded interest income or other non‑operating items that contributed to the EPS beat. ADC Therapeutics did not provide explicit forward guidance for future quarters, which is common for early‑stage biotechnology firms lacking approved product sales. The company’s management likely emphasized strategic priorities such as advancing Zynlonta in additional indications, exploring combination therapies, and pursuing partnerships to share development costs. Given the lack of revenue, the company may need to raise additional capital in the near term to fund operations, potentially through equity offerings, debt, or collaboration payments. Risk factors include uncertainty about future clinical trial outcomes, regulatory timelines, and competitive pressures from other CD19‑targeted therapies. The EPS beat, while positive, may not be sustainable if operating expenses increase as trials expand. The company’s cash position and burn rate remain key metrics to watch, as they dictate the runway before further financing is needed. Investors should anticipate volatility as the company continues to operate without a commercial revenue stream.
